Both Suspension Design Engineers and Chassis Engineers work in automotive design, often collaborating on vehicle performance. Suspension Engineers focus on developing and testing suspension systems to improve ride quality and handling, while Chassis Engineers work on the overall vehicle frame and structural integrity. What are Suspension Design Engineers?

Suspension Design Engineers are professionals who specialize in designing, developing, and testing vehicle suspension systems. These systems are crucial for ensuring ride comfort, handling, and safety by managing how a vehicle responds to road conditions. Suspension Design Engineers work closely with other automotive engineers to create components like springs, shock absorbers, and control arms, often using computer-aided design (CAD) software and simulation tools. Their role also involves prototyping, analyzing test data, and making improvements to meet performance and regulatory requirements.

What are some common challenges faced by Suspension Design Engineers during the development process?

Suspension Design Engineers often encounter challenges related to balancing performance, comfort, and cost constraints. They must ensure that their designs meet strict safety and regulatory standards while also accommodating manufacturing limitations and tight deadlines. Additionally, collaborating closely with cross-functional teams—such as vehicle dynamics, manufacturing, and testing—requires strong communication and problem-solving skills to integrate feedback and quickly address unforeseen issues during prototyping and validation phases.

Summary:

The DRE will be responsible for design from concept to production, release, and launch of chassis suspension structures components, systems, and sub-systems for vehicle programs. This individual will be depended on to build strong partnerships with internal team members responsible for design, validation, procurement, and manufacturing of the vehicle.

Responsibilities:

  • Design and release the chassis suspension structures components and assemblies from concept to production
  • Develop and mature components from concept through production
  • Establish and achieve targets for cost, investment, weight, performance, and quality
  • Coordinate engineering designs and systems with purchasing, suppliers, testing team, manufacturing team, other vehicle subsystems and functions
  • Responsible for quality of components and/or subsystem 3D CAD and technical drawings
  • Work with suppliers to create specifications and requirements of the components.
  • Provide technical support and system analysis for root cause analysis of development issues
  • Provide professional reports and documentation for the system with information provided by design responsible engineers
  • Coordinate, lead and participate in design reviews
  • Work multi-functionally to implement cost reduction methods and product improvements, and to support prototype and production build activities
  • Remain up-to-date in relevant new technology and products
  • Travel as required
  • Perform other duties as needed

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ering plus 5 years relevant experience.
  • Education with the following specialties preferred: Mechanical, Mechanical Technology, Aerospace, Automotive, Manufacturing.
  • 3 years' experience designing chassis suspension structures (suspension arms, links, knuckles etc.)
  • Knowledge and working experience with DFMEA (Design Failure Mode and Effect Analysis) and GD&T (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ing)
  • Familiarity with the engineering design components.
  • Hands-on CAD experience in 3D and drawing creation in CATIA V5/V6
  • The ability to work effectively in a cross functional group setting, including essential technical guidance to support Senior Management.
  • The ability to work independently, and to lead, coach and mentor others.
  • Knowledge of materials, manufacturing processes, and tooling.
